Crypto Market Reacts to Unexpected US CPI Data, Altcoins See Volatility

CoinsTelegraph
Crypto Analyst
April 12, 2026 April 12, 2026 (Updated) 2 min read 0 Comments

The cryptocurrency market is currently navigating a period of uncertainty as it responds to the latest US Consumer Price Index (CPI) data. Released earlier today, the figures indicated a higher-than-expected inflation rate, immediately triggering a ripple effect across various asset classes, including digital currencies. This unexpected data point has led to increased volatility, particularly affecting altcoins.

The Immediate Market Reaction

Following the CPI announcement, Bitcoin (BTC) and Ethereum (ETH) initially showed modest declines, reflecting a cautious approach from larger institutional players. However, the altcoin market experienced a more pronounced downturn. Many smaller cryptocurrencies saw significant price drops, as investors quickly reassessed their risk exposure. This knee-jerk reaction highlights the sensitivity of altcoins to broader macroeconomic signals and investor sentiment. Key Factors Driving Volatility

  • Inflation Concerns: The higher-than-anticipated CPI reading raises concerns about the Federal Reserve’s future monetary policy decisions. The potential for further interest rate hikes could diminish the attractiveness of risk-on assets like cryptocurrencies.
  • Risk-Off Sentiment: Investors often retreat from riskier assets during periods of economic uncertainty. This flight to safety typically benefits traditional safe havens, which can put downward pressure on crypto prices.
  • Altcoin Sensitivity: Altcoins are known for their higher volatility and are often disproportionately affected by market corrections. Their smaller market caps and lower liquidity make them more susceptible to rapid price swings.

What’s Next?

As the market digests this latest data, several scenarios could unfold. If inflation concerns persist, we may see further price corrections. Conversely, if the market perceives the CPI data as a temporary blip, we could see a rebound. It’s crucial for investors to stay informed and exercise caution. Overall, the crypto market’s reaction to the US CPI data underscores the critical interplay between macroeconomic factors and digital asset valuations. The coming days will be critical in determining whether this is a short-term correction or the beginning of a more sustained downturn.
